    Abstract: A railway car hatch cover includes an exterior shell cover, a gasket, and a mounting ring. The exterior shell cover has an outer-side and an under-side. The gasket is a vented gasket or a non-vented gasket, and the gasket is mounted to the mounting ring. The mounting ring is secured to the under-side of the exterior shell cover. The mounting ring is removable, and the gasket is replaceable with a second gasket. The second gasket can be vented or non-vented. The mounting ring is reinstallable on the under-side of the exterior shell cover. The replaceable gasket allows a single hatch cover to function as a vented hatch cover or a non-vented hatch cover depending on the type of gasket installed.

    Abstract: A railcar handbrake wheel of polymeric composition including an outer ring connected to a hub by at least two spokes. The hub containing an insert or core molded into the hub. The core is a shaft member having a first end and a second end, with a head connected to the first end. The head on the first end of the core having a greater cross-sectional area than the second end of the core. The core containing an opening extending from the first end to the second end.

    Abstract: A method of calculating the cost saving for producing a metallic component by the use of a powder metal process is provided. The method includes the steps of analyzing the current production method of the component, usually machining, to determine the current unit cost. The customer would agree to purchase an agreed supply of components for an agreed period of time for the components that could be supplied with an agreed cost savings. The production of the component utilizing powder metal process is then analyzed to determine the powder metal unit cost. The savings for production of the component utilizing the powder metal process is then presented to the customer. The customer could agree to purchase the agreed supply of components for an agreed period of time. If agreed, the test production of the component utilizing a powder metal process is then performed. If successful, a final tooling and production quotation for the production of the component is then provided to the customer.
